Austin, TX (March 12, 2025) – A vehicle collision resulting in injuries was reported in Austin on Tuesday evening. The crash occurred around 5:16 p.m. in the 7601 block of Daffan Ln in Travis County.
Emergency responders from Austin Fire and Rescue arrived at the scene to assist the injured. First responders, including paramedics, assessed and treated individuals hurt in the crash. However, the exact number of victims and the severity of their injuries remain unknown at this time.
Authorities temporarily restricted traffic in the area while clearing the roadway and investigating the cause of the collision. Law enforcement has not released further details regarding the circumstances leading up to the crash.

Car Accidents in Texas
Texas sees a significant number of auto accidents each year, with urban areas like Austin experiencing frequent collisions due to high traffic volume. Roadways such as Daffan Ln can be particularly dangerous when drivers are distracted, speeding, or failing to yield properly.
After a crash, victims often face challenges such as medical expenses, lost income, and insurance disputes. Because Texas follows a fault-based insurance system, injured individuals may pursue compensation from the party responsible for the accident.
